Thank you for sharing the script, however, I got this error:
SELECT LEFT(mbxdisplayname, 20) AS 'Mailbox',
exchangecomputer AS 'Exchange Server',
mbxitemcount AS '#Items (Mailbox)',
VS1.archiveditems AS '#Items (Archive)',
mbxsize / 1024 AS 'Mbx Size (MB)',
VS1.archiveditemssize / 1024 AS 'Archive Size(MB)',
( mbxsize + VS1.archiveditemssize ) / 1024 AS 'Total Size(MB)',
VS1.createddate AS 'Archive Created',
VS1.modifieddate AS 'Archive Updated',
mbxexchangestate AS 'Exchange State'
FROM enterprisevaultdirectory.dbo.exchangemailboxentry AS EME,
enterprisevaultdirectory.dbo.exchangeserverentry AS ESE,
evvaultstore1..archivepoint AS VS1
WHERE EME.defaultvaultid = VS1.archivepointid
AND EME.mbxarchivingstate = 1
AND EME.exchangeserveridentity = ESE.exchangeserveridentity
Msg 207, Level 16, State 1, Line 16
Invalid column name 'exchangeserveridentity'.
when I executed against the EV 9.0.4 DB on my Exchange Server 2007 ?